E.2. Air Pollution

Air pollution has worsened due to four major factors: the surge in vehicular traffic, expanding urban areas, fast-paced economic growth, and accelerating industrialization—all contributing to the release of harmful substances into the atmosphere.

Major air pollutants and their sources

Carbon monoxide (CO)

  • Carbon monoxide is a colorless and odorless gas formed during the incomplete combustion of carbon-containing fuels like petrol, diesel, and wood. 
  • It is also released when both natural and synthetic materials, such as cigarettes, are burned.
  • It lowers the amount of oxygen that enters our blood. It can slow our reflexes and make us confused and sleepy.

Carbon dioxide CO2

  • Principe greenhouse gas

Chlorofluorocarbons (CFC)

  • Gases that are released mainly from air-conditioning systems and refrigeration. 
  • When released into the air, CFCs rise to the stratosphere, where they come in contact with few other gases, which lead to a reduction of the ozone layer that protects the earth from the harmful ultraviolet rays of the sun.

Lead

  • Present in petrol, diesel, lead batteries, paints, hair dye products, etc.
  • Affects children in particular.
  • Cause nervous system damage and digestive problems and, in some cases, cause cancer.

Ozone

  • Occurs naturally in the upper layers of the atmosphere.
  • At-the ground level, it is a pollutant with highly toxic effects.
  • Vehicles and industries are the major source of ground-level ozone emissions.
  • Ozone makes our eyes itch, burn, and water. It lowers our resistance to cold and pneumonia.

Nitrogen oxide (Nox)

  • Causes smog and acid rain. It is produced from burning fuels including petrol, diesel, and Coal.
  • Nitrogen oxide can make children susceptible to respiratory diseases in winters.

Suspended particulate matter (SPM)

  • Consists of solids in the air in the form of smoke, dust, and vapour that can remain suspended for extended periods
  • The finer of these particles when breathed in can lodge in our lungs and cause lung damage and respiratory problems.

Sulphur dioxide (SO2)

  • A gas produced from burning coal, mainly in thermal power plants.
  • Some industrial processes, such as production of paper and smelting of metals, produce sulphur dioxide.
  • A major contributor to smog and acid rain.
  • Sulphur dioxide can lead to lung diseases

Smog

  • A combination of the words fog and smoke. Smog is a condition of fog that had soot or smoke in it.
  • Interaction of sunlight with certain chemicals in the atmosphere.
  • Primary components of photochemical smog is ozone.

Other Pollutants

Volatile organic compounds

  • The main indoor sources are perfumes, hair sprays, furniture polish, glues, air fresheners, moth repellents, wood preservatives, and other products.
  • Biological pollutants – It includes pollen from plants, mite, and hair from pets, fungi, parasites, and some bacteria.

Formaldehyde

  • Mainly from carpets, particle boards, and insulation foam. It causes irritation to the eyes and nose and allergies.

Radon

  • It is a gas that is emitted naturally by the soil. Due to modern houses having poor ventilation, it is confined inside the house and causes lung cancers.

Policy measures of MoEF (Ministry of Environment,Forest and Climate Change)

Important measures

  • The Ministry of Environment and Forests vide its notification in 2009, has made it mandatory to use Fly Ash based products in all construction projects, road embankment works and low lying land filling works within 100 kms radius of Thermal Power Station.
  • To use Fly Ash in mine filling activities within a 50 kms radius of Thermal Power Stations.
  • Arresters: These are used to separate particulate matters from contaminated air.
  • Scrubbers: These are used to clean air for both dusts and gases by passing it through a dry or wet packing material.

Government Initiatives

National Air Quality Monitoring Programme

  • In India, the Central Pollution Control Board (CPCB) has been executing a nationwide programme of ambient air quality monitoring known as National Air Quality Monitoring Programme (NAMP). 

The National Air Quality Monitoring Programme (NAMP) is undertaken in India:

  • (i) To determine status and trends of ambient air quality.
    (ii) to ascertain the compliance of NAAQS.
    (iii) to identify non-attainment cities.
    (iv) to understand the natural process of cleaning in the atmosphere; and
    (v) to undertake preventive and corrective measures.
  • Annual average concentration of SOx levels are within the prescribed National Ambient Air Quality Standards (NAAQS).
  • National Ambient Air Quality Standards (NAAas) were notified in the year 1982, duly revised in 1994 based on health criteria and land uses.
  • The NAAQS have been revisited and revised in November 2009 for 12 pollutants, which include, Sulphur dioxide (S02), nitrogen dioxide (N02), particulate matter having size less than 10 micron.
  • (PM 10),particulate matter having size less than 2.5micron (PM2.5), ozone, lead, carbon monoxide (CO), arsenic, nickel, benzene, ammonia, and. Benzopyrene.
